Output 426fb8760e73ecf2cdffeec5083ddcaaeae851691ff1a80be1cab944d42e39a4:1

value
149032
script pubkey
OP_0 OP_PUSHBYTES_20 e2bab107c925ebec9e61d68b14befcc6a0b2bde7
address
bc1qu2atzp7fyh47e8np6693f0huc6st90088220l8
transaction
426fb8760e73ecf2cdffeec5083ddcaaeae851691ff1a80be1cab944d42e39a4
confirmations
183146
spent
true